图形化编程学的是什么
-
图形化编程学是一种通过图形界面来进行编程的方法。传统的编程语言通常需要使用特定的语法和符号来编写代码,而图形化编程则使用图形和图标来表示代码的逻辑和功能。通过拖拽和连接图标,可以轻松地创建程序的流程和逻辑,而无需手动编写代码。
图形化编程通常用于教育和初学者学习编程。它提供了一种直观、可视化的方式来理解和学习编程概念和原理。对于初学者来说,图形化编程减少了对语法的依赖,使他们能够更快地上手和理解编程的基本概念。同时,图形化编程也可以帮助学生培养逻辑思维和解决问题的能力。
除了教育领域,图形化编程也在一些领域中得到了应用。例如,可视化编程软件可以帮助设计师和艺术家创建交互式的图形界面和动画效果。此外,图形化编程还被广泛应用于物联网和机器人领域,用于控制和编程各种设备和机器人。
总的来说,图形化编程是一种简化和可视化的编程方法,适用于教育、艺术、物联网和机器人等领域。它为初学者提供了一种易于理解和上手的方式,同时也在实际应用中发挥了重要的作用。
1年前 -
图形化编程是一种通过图形界面来进行编程的方法。它使用图形符号和图形元素代替传统的编程语言的代码,使编程变得更加直观和易于理解。学习图形化编程可以帮助人们掌握编程的基本概念和逻辑思维,并能够快速构建简单的程序和应用。
学习图形化编程可以带来以下几个方面的收益:
-
提高编程入门的门槛:相比于传统的编程语言,图形化编程更容易理解和上手。它使用图形元素和符号,而不是复杂的代码语法,使初学者能够更快地掌握编程的基本概念和逻辑思维。
-
培养逻辑思维能力:图形化编程要求学习者通过拖拽、连接和设置图形元素来创建程序。这个过程中需要学习者理解问题的逻辑关系和解决方法,培养逻辑思维能力和问题解决能力。
-
增强创造力和想象力:图形化编程提供了丰富的图形元素和交互组件,学习者可以通过自由组合这些元素来创建各种有趣的程序和应用。这样可以激发学习者的创造力和想象力,培养他们的创造性思维和创新能力。
-
培养团队合作精神:在学习图形化编程的过程中,学习者可以与其他人一起合作,共同解决问题和完成项目。这样可以培养学习者的团队合作精神和沟通能力,提升他们在团队中的协作能力。
-
实践应用技能:图形化编程可以应用于各个领域,如游戏开发、机器人控制、数据可视化等。通过学习图形化编程,学习者可以将所学知识应用于实际项目中,提升他们的实践应用能力和解决实际问题的能力。
1年前 -
-
图形化编程是指使用图形化界面进行编程的一种方法。它通过将编程语言的代码转化为图形化的模块化块,使编程更加直观和易于理解。图形化编程通常用于教学和初学者学习编程的入门阶段。
图形化编程的学习内容主要包括以下几个方面:
-
基本编程概念:学习编程的基本概念,如变量、循环、条件判断等。通过图形化界面,学习者可以直观地了解这些概念的作用和使用方法。
-
程序逻辑设计:学习如何设计程序的逻辑结构,包括顺序执行、选择结构和循环结构等。通过图形化编程工具,学习者可以将这些结构以图形块的形式组合起来,形成完整的程序流程。
-
数据处理与算法:学习如何处理数据和设计算法。通过图形化编程工具,可以利用各种数据处理模块和算法模块,实现数据的输入、输出和处理。
-
事件驱动编程:学习事件驱动编程的基本原理和方法。通过图形化编程工具,可以通过拖拽和连接事件块和处理块,实现程序对事件的响应和处理。
-
图形界面设计:学习如何设计图形界面,包括窗口、按钮、文本框等。通过图形化编程工具,可以直观地设计和布局界面,并实现用户与界面的交互。
在学习图形化编程时,可以选择一些常用的图形化编程工具,如Scratch、Blockly等,这些工具提供了丰富的图形化编程模块和示例,可以帮助学习者快速上手和理解编程的基本概念和技巧。
总之,图形化编程是一种直观、易学的编程方法,适合初学者入门和快速理解编程概念。通过学习图形化编程,可以培养学习者的逻辑思维能力和解决问题的能力,并为进一步学习其他编程语言和开发工具打下坚实的基础。
1年前 -